Good morning! It’s 30th January, and here’s your Netherlands daily news capsule.
EU places Iranian Revolutionary Guard on terrorism list following protester deaths.
Den Bosch cancels extra carnival day, aiming to return to traditional roots.
Protests erupt in Utrecht against police violence, with accusations of racism.
USS Abraham Lincoln arrives with 5,000 troops, as Trump warns Iran of conflict.
US faces potential government shutdown as Senate leaders negotiate budget deal.
Multiple accidents reported in Northeast Netherlands due to icy conditions.
New guidelines for ICE require criminal links for targets after two deaths.
Meta's massive investments lead to 30% growth, despite challenges in Europe.
Apple acquires Israeli company known for Xbox Kinect technology, boosting its AI efforts.
Rotterdam kicks off the 55th International Film Festival with star-studded events.
Doctors prescribe more weight-loss medications to obesity patients amid rising demand.
Fiona speaks out on being childless, refusing to justify her life choices.
Where is the 'super flu'? Fewer people are getting sick this year despite concerns.
